SC seeks written explanation over Durga Prasai’s arrest



KATHMANDU: The Supreme Court has ordered authorities to submit a written explanation within 24 hours regarding the arrest of medical entrepreneur Durga Prasai.

A single bench of Justice Mahesh Sharma Poudel issued the order on Wednesday in response to a habeas corpus petition filed by advocate Ashish Luitel on behalf of Prasai, who is currently being held at the District Police Range, Bhaktapur.

The court directed authorities to submit a written response through the Office of the Attorney General within 24 hours, stating the legal grounds and reasons behind the arrest.

The order states that the explanation must be submitted within the specified timeframe excluding travel time.
